#150877 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#150877 is composed of 8.2% red, 3.1%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.4% cyan, 93.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 247 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 24.9%. #150877 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a10ee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#150877

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020109 is the darkest color, while #f6f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#150877

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e3e41 is the less saturated color, while #11037c is the most saturated one.
